Покуражимся ( Courage блог)

  • вклинил сюда типа оглавления
    ================================================================
    TT3200 и vdr и xine (рабочая связка) октябрь-нояврь 2007
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.
    =================================================================
    S2-3200
    внешний вид и камни
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.


    потестил я тут S2-3200 на предмет приема низкоскоростных каналов
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.
    температура карты
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.


    установка и работа с родным софтом в виндах
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.


    работа в виндах с AltDVB
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.


    =================================================================
    Линукс-драйвер S2-3200
    где что
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.


    сборка V4L модулей из репозитария Ману
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.


    укороченный и облегченный вариант устаноки драйверорв для TT s2-3200
    в дебиан
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.


    драйвер для платы TT s2-3200 не являются рабочим
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.


    неудачная попытка сборки модифмцмрованного szap
    который умеет переключать dvb-s2\
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.


    =======================================================================
    сборки и установки линукс кернела 2.6.17 в дебиан
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.


    сборка v4l-dvb из девелопских репозитариев используя систему меркури
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.
    ============================ END of bloglist =======================================


    """вот оно началось подумал князь Андрей"""
    начну прямо с середины - вступление - завязку и развитие потом напишу )))

    фронтэнд для ffmpeg mplayer и .............. vdr !!!!!!!!!!
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.


    дебиан пакеты там тоже есть - но не встают !!!

    """ доктор! не стоит! зато как висит! """


    чтож - соберем из исходных но

    Исходный код
    debian:/home/courage/kmplayer/kmplayer-0.9.1c# ./configure
    checking build system type... i686-pc-linux-gnu
    .....................................................
    checking for snprintf... yes
    checking for X... configure: error: Can't find X includes. Please check your installation and add the correct paths!


    порылся в гугле вроде как надо xdevel


    мама дорогая - сколько всего ))))))))) и что будем робить хлопцы?

  • хотя это и не совсем блоги получаются а нечто типа заметок "чтобы не забылось"
    но обещаю потом и рассуждения на общие темы писать - идей много и рассказать
    есть что а пока надо удовлетворрить себя в смысле линукс десктопной системы )))
    как виндузятник со стажем - вижу пока единственное преимущество дебиан перед
    виндами- ее бесплатность ... а недостатков ... они есть....уже чувствую как взметнулись
    брови у адептов только линукс )))) но - где-то читал и целиком с этим согласен -
    линукс как десктопная операционка - это игра на чужом поле ))) да! все есть -
    все приложения для обычногго десктопщика - но все равно линукс-десктоп догоняет
    вин-десктоп..... вот где линукс первый из первых - это сервер ... мощь
    командной строки.....
    в-общем геймеру геймерову..... секретарше секретаршево .... системному админу - линукс )))


    -------------------------------------------------------
    ну вот я и в testing версии дебиан (примерно 4 часа при установке из интернета)


    несколько слов по горячим следам - при запуске задал режим expert что позволило
    1. выбрать не одну локаль а несколько (основная локаль англ. + все русские
    2. выбрать вариант кернела - выбрал 2.6.15
    3. почему то нет возможности выбора таймзоны не из американских зон - но это
    можно поправить легко потом
    4. при установке машины как десктопа устанавливается только gnome - kde ставлю
    отдельно еще 209 метров apt-get install kde
    5. при конфиге х не спросил тип видео адаптера (сарж спрашивал ) но поставил
    похоже правильно хотя не знаю точно - пока не знаю
    6. в гноме не нашел как указать клавиатурную комбинацию для переключения
    раскладок и не нашел почему то опеноффисе - хотя при загрузке грузились
    2 файла от него - 50 метров
    7. в стандартной поставке включен браузер файрфокс - что приятно


    продолжу после установки кде - он мне более симпатичен )))

  • итак, обживаюсь в кде debian etch = testing ....
    доустановил :


    1) mc - куда же без него


    2) k3b
    debian:/home/courage# apt-get install k3b
    Reading package lists... Done
    Building dependency tree... Done
    The following extra packages will be installed:
    cdparanoia libflac++5 libk3b2 libmpcdec3 libresmgr1
    Suggested packages:
    k3b-i18n normalize-audio toolame sox movixmaker-2
    Recommended packages:
    vcdimager cdrdao dvd+rw-tools resmgr


    доставил и эти все пакеты что он рекомендовал


    3) ffmpeg


    4) kmplayer
    очередное спасибо free-x
    в /etc/apt/sources.list надо дописать deb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у. etch main
    и
    apt-get update
    apt-get install kmplayer


    5) mplayer
    ( можно и mplayer поставить с ftp.nerim.net но я поторопился и собрал его из исходных)
    для сборки mplayer требуется gcc 3.x версия - поставил gcc 3.4
    configure прошел - только надо кодеки в /usr/local/lib/codecs/ забросить 8,9 м с их же сайта
    а фонты с их же сайта в /usr/local/share/mplayer/font/
    но что то этот mplayer у меня не заработал ((( честно - не очень и хотелось )))


    некоторые проблемы - большие и маленькие:


    1) раскладка клавы в кде нельзя сделать как в гноме -
    как в виндах - точка и запятая черти где находятся
    спасибо free-x за подсказку - вариант находится чуть
    ниже сontril center-> regional -> keyboard layout -> layout variant -> winkeys



    2) не запускается к3b-setup (запускается с пустым окном)
    для того чтобы сделать запуск от имени рута cd-record (((
    посему диски писать не хочет (((


    эта проблема оказывается существует
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.


    решение было найдено здесь
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.


    Crust - 10.03.2006, 01:36 Uhr
    Titel: RE: Problem with k3b and cdrdao feffer777:
    Actually, I just discovered this today. The k3bsetup and k3bsetup tools are too old and are not compatible with Debian. They have been left out. Just set the permissions yourself with the following commands (as root):


    * dpkg-statoverride --add --update root cdrom 4750 /usr/bin/cdrecord
    * dpkg-statoverride --add --update root cdrom 4750 /usr/bin/cdrecord.shm
    * dpkg-statoverride --add --update root cdrom 4750 /usr/bin/cdrecord.mmap
    * dpkg-statoverride --add --update root cdrom 4750 /usr/bin/readcd
    * dpkg-statoverride --add --update root cdrom 4710 /usr/bin/cdrdao
    * dpkg-statoverride --add --update root cdrom 4710 /usr/bin/mkisofs


    * adduser username cdrom


    Hope this helps,
    -Crust


    3) в тотем видео плайере надо перед проигрыванием двд дисков обязательно
    монтировать диск - в сарж он его сразу видел


    Failed to find mountpoint for device /dev/hdb in /etc/fstab


    хотя в /etc/fstab есть такая строка
    /dev/hdb /media/cdrom0 udf,iso9660 user,noauto 0 0


    и что ему надо?

  • ты меня подбил на debian - я сегодня иксы запустил с правильным разрешением и количеством цветов, так что тоже маленькая победа есть :)


    предлагаю на список рассылки по дебиану подписаться - там тоже можем встретиться со своими чайницкими вопросами :)


    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.

  • это был подход №2 - на очереди подход №3 - уже stable
    инсталяция testing дистра )) - винт 200 гигов уже куплен - теперь надо
    как правильно сделать чтобы снова не качать пакеты из сети ...
    ни много ни мало 656 метров


    читаю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.
    (полезный очень фак - спасибо за него)


    # apt-get install apt-move
    # apt-move update


    и если ничего не менять в /etc/apt-move.conf то в /mirrors/debian
    ляжет зеркало файлов всех пакетов закачаных по apt-get
    при этом оригиналы в /var/cache/apt/archives/ остались


    видимо еще надо исправить такую вещь
    /mirrors/debian/dists/stable на testing или не надо?


    теперь надо придумать как это зеркало подсунуть инсталятору
    ... пока придумал положить его или на дрим или на вынь машину
    (и там и там подняты фтп серверы - только надо их сконфигурировать -
    видимо на анонимный доступ)


    Akkermanec
    дело в том что если диск смонтировать - он нормально крутится - но это
    лишнее телодвижение - в sarge тотем плэйер без отдельного монтирования
    диск начинал крутить

  • ну он у меня в Etch и крутится тока в фстабе у меня написанно подругому


    /dev/hdc /media/cdrom0 iso9660 ro,user,noauto 0 0



    нет udf kак у тебя

  • goga777 навел на submount


    первым делом нужны исходные ядра и линк на них в
    /lib/modules/(kernel version)/build



    в моем варианте - это
    /lib/modules/2.6.15-1-486/build
    качаю с kernel.org linux-2.6.15.1.tar.bz2
    они и так и так нужны будут ))


    в дримбиан такие линки
    lrwxr-xr-x 1 root root 26 Dec 21 17:01 build -> /usr/local/src/linux-2.6.9
    lrwxr-xr-x 1 root root 26 Jan 4 23:03 source -> /usr/local/src/linux-2.6.9


    распаковал исходные в /usr/local/src/linux-2.6.15.1 создал линк
    и
    /home/courage/submount/submount-0.9/subfs-0.9# make
    и ......... 3 листа ошибок ))))))))
    пока на этом останов - halt )))


    может исходные не те немного или .... не знаю .....


    ? где найти конфиг по которому собирался кернел из дистра etch
    и собственно исходные 2.6.15-1-486 из чего он собирался?

  • ну в-общем исходные были не те конечно ))) нужные найдены здесь
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.


    вот их адреса для 2.6.15-1-486
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.


    почему то по apt-get их не скачать - а посему скачал их по фтп и установил dpkg -i
    после установки они легли в /usr/src (2 директории и автоматом же и линк built создался
    в /lib/modules.... и дальше этот submount нормально собрался и проинсталился


    после монтирования mount -t subfs /dev/hdb /mnt/cdrom -o fs=iso9660,ro
    и хотя бы однократного обращения к диску - диск фиг вынешь ))))))))
    даже если размонтировать umount /mnt/cdrom все одно диск залочен ))))
    и ни кнопкой и никак ))))) только фомкой ))))
    может на арвдр нормально заработает этот submount ?

  • очередное огромное спасибо free-x ---- из нашей беседы получился мини-фак
    по исходным ядра в дебиан ))))


    -Andrew
    что такое kernel headers и чем они отличаются от исходных ядра?
    -sysad free-x
    kernel-headers eto light variant ot vsego isxodnika jadra


    -Andrew
    из headers и этого конфига можно кернел собрать? или этого мало будет?
    -sysad free-x
    header eto ob'javlenija funkcij, tipov dannyx ... t.e. deklaracii ... v osnom ix dostatochno chtoby ssylat'sja na nix a ne tjagat' 100 MB vsego kernelja
    iz header ty ne soberesh' kernel ...


    -Andrew
    значит их для сборки кернела будет недостаточно (((( а есть в дебиан исходные полные из которых они кернелы собирают?
    -sysad free-x
    apt-cache search kernel-source
    a stop...oni tam sejchas pomenjali
    uzhe ne kernel-source eto nazyvaetsja a linux-source
    -Andrew
    courage@debian:~$ apt-cache search linux-source
    linux-patch-debian-2.6.15 - Debian patches to version 2.6.15 of the Linux kernel
    linux-source-2.6.15 - Linux kernel source for version 2.6.15 with Debian patches
    linux-tree-2.6.15 - Linux kernel source tree for building Debian kernel images


    -Andrew
    где лежит если лежит конфиг по которому собирался кернел из дистра дебиан?
    -sysad free-x
    /boot/config*

  • а вот подскажи, Courage :)


    стоит у меня к примеру Sarge, а я хочу обновить свой мейлер sylpheed-claws до самой последней версии. Но для Sarge я не нахожу этого пакета в репозитариях, для него вообще старье какое-то находится. Но для testing, а особенно для unstable можно найти свежий пакет.
    Есть ли какие способы установки на Sarge пакетов, которые предназначены для более новых версий ? (в backports не нашел ничего) или надо переходить на testing version ?

  • Цитата

    Со слов пользователя Courage
    goga777 навел на submount


    и на Supermount
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.
    и на ivman наведу :)
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.

  • Цитата

    Со слов пользователя Courage
    после монтирования mount -t subfs /dev/hdb /mnt/cdrom -o fs=iso9660,ro
    и хотя бы однократного обращения к диску - диск фиг вынешь ))))))))
    даже если размонтировать umount /mnt/cdrom все одно диск залочен ))))
    и ни кнопкой и никак ))))) только фомкой ))))


    а ты eject-ом, eject-ом его :)
    Пожалуйста зарегистрируйся для просмотра данной ссылки на страницу.

  • Цитата

    Со слов пользователя Гога777
    а вот подскажи, Courage :)


    стоит у меня к примеру Sarge, а я хочу обновить свой мейлер sylpheed-claws до самой последней версии. Но для Sarge я не нахожу этого пакета в репозитариях, для него вообще старье какое-то находится. Но для тестинг, а особенно для unstable можно найти свежий пакет.
    Есть ли какие способы установки на Sarge пакетов, которые предназначены для более новых версий ? (в backports не нашел ничего) или надо переходить на тестинг версион ?


    Я не Courage ;)
    Самому пересобрать пакеты
    Добавляем в /etc/apt/sources.list

    Исходный код
    deb-src http://source.rfc822.org/debian sid main  non-free contrib


    обновляемся,тянем сырцы нужного пакета, доставляем пакеты, которые понадобятся для сборки и собираем пакет....


    остается тебе их только установить

  • все хорошо, но ты привел очень древнюю версию пакета -
    sylpheed-claws-1.0.5 - для них нет проблем , я как раз спрашивал - что делать, если для Sarge я нигде не могу найти версию 2.0 и выше ? они есть только в testing и unstable

  • во-во и о том, и таких ситуаций, когда в сарже я не смогу найти свежих пакетов будет много. Проблема не только в сульфиде, а и во многих других пакетах. Так что вопрос общий


    что делать в таких ситуациях ?


    вижу варианты


    - переходить на testing version
    - портировать этот пакет на sarge из testing или unstable (возможно ли ?)
    - устанавливать из исходников
    - самому собирать deb пакет из исходников
    - ставить пакет из testing в сарж - (наверное не прокатит).


    реально ?

  • универсального ответа нет ... так же как и той поговорке о "вкусе и цвете" ...
    Ты хочешь всю дистрибуцию самую свежую или только 2-3 пакета или вообще смертельный "коктейль" или как?

  • ну, в принципе хочу иметь свежие пакеты тех программ, которые активно использую


    Опера, сульфид, свен, ася, xchat, ну еще штук пяток наберется...

  • но эти пакеты могут зависить от кучи других пакетов например самых новых библиотек (например gtk) и т.д. Поэтому все не ограничится именно этими программами. =)
    Может иногда полезно пожертвовать фишками во имя стабильности?
    Например я могу себе представить (вернее так и делаю), что мой desktop - это testing/unstable, но при этом я держу запасные выходы для откатов (например паралельная установка нескоких оконных менеджеров, вдруг во время апдейта что то снесется на фиг ....бывало и такое, претензии предьявлять некому) ... но мои серваки это всегда stable.